Title: Trenching and Excavation
Description: This course focuses on OSHA standards and the safety aspects of excavation and trenching. Students are introduced to practical soil mechanics and its relationship to the stability of shored and unshored slopes and walls of excavations. Various types of shoring (wood timbers and hydraulic) are covered. Testing methods are demonstrated and a half-day field exercise is conducted, allowing students to use instruments such as penetrometers, torvane shears, and engineering rods.
